Bitfinex and Tether Launch Keet, Peer-to-Peer Video Calling App

Crypto companies Bitfinex and Tether have stepped into a new business and created a peer-to-peer encrypted video calling (P2P) application.

Sister companies collaborated with a company called Hypercore to launch Keet, a peer-to-peer video calling app.

Bitfinex CTO Paolo Ardoino stated that Bitfinex and Tether companies have invested $10 million in the Keet project so far and will continue to invest up to $100 million.

In the Keet application, users will be able to make audio and video calls, send messages and share files. In this application, users will be able to find and connect to each other using cryptographic key pairs.

In this way, it is aimed to ensure a complete security environment and prevent third parties from obtaining these images.

Mentioning that the project has been built for 5 years, CTO Paolo Ardoino continued his words as follows:

The project we are working on is a platform that aims to give users access to applications and freedom of speech. You can talk and share without fear of being listened to or having your data recorded.

The alpha version of the application can be downloaded from the website, and the mobile application is planned to be released in November.
